The protocol also includes the following features to enable additional flexibility for rewards distribution:
20+
- Operator Directed Rewards: AVSs can now direct performance-based rewards to specific Operators using custom logic. This allows rewards to be distributed based on work completion, quality or other parameters determined by the AVS, allowing flexible and tailored incentives. Operators registered to AVSs for the specified duration are eligible. This approach enables customization and diverse reward mechanisms that can be attributed on-chain, aligning incentives with Operator contributions.
21+
- Variable Operator Fees for AVS Rewards: Operators can now set their per-AVS fee rate on AVS rewards to any amount from 0% to 100%, deviating from the 10% default split. Changes to this split take effect after a 7-day activation delay. The ability to set a variable split per-AVS allows Operators to align their fee structures with their economic needs and the complexity and diversity of AVS demands.
22+
- Variable Operator Splits for Programmatic Incentives: Operators can set their split of Programmatic Incentives to any amount from 0% to 100%, so that Operators have flexibility in determining the appropriate take rate. Changes to this split take effect after a 7-day activation delay. These splits integrate seamlessly with the existing reward distribution model, ensuring that stakers delegating to Operators benefit proportionately.

Operators and Stakers are both categorized as "Earners" when it comes to claiming and are distinct by their addresses. Actual reward calculations are explained further in the [technical docs](https://github.com/Layr-Labs/eigenlayer-contracts/blob/dev/docs/core/RewardsCoordinator.md). To summarize, reward calculations are performed daily by snapshotting the on-chain state. Once a week on mainnet and daily on testnet, a Merkle root is posted to the contract that allows earners to claim their updated earnings.

### Setting Designated Claimers
3634
Earners (Stakers and Operators) can set a claimer address that can claim rewards for the tokens they've earned. An Earner is its own claimer by default and only the claimer address can claim rewards. If a new claimer is set, the new address can claim all of the previously unclaimed rewards. The Earner can always change their designated claimer address.
